X-Git-Url: https://git.lttng.org/?p=lttng-tools.git;a=blobdiff_plain;f=src%2Fcommon%2Factions%2Faction.c;h=64864a6273ae1fabac87cd8e6fd813831335f9d0;hp=07eefeeb050ab14877abcf2d55ac4b93e78d91b1;hb=7f4d5b07cf7be895b38b69073389a4fcc318ec29;hpb=72365501d3148ca977a09bad8de0ec51b427bdd8 diff --git a/src/common/actions/action.c b/src/common/actions/action.c index 07eefeeb0..64864a627 100644 --- a/src/common/actions/action.c +++ b/src/common/actions/action.c @@ -8,9 +8,9 @@ #include #include #include -#include #include #include +#include #include #include #include @@ -51,7 +51,7 @@ void lttng_action_init(struct lttng_action *action, action_serialize_cb serialize, action_equal_cb equal, action_destroy_cb destroy, - action_get_firing_policy_cb get_firing_policy) + action_get_rate_policy_cb get_rate_policy) { urcu_ref_init(&action->ref); action->type = type; @@ -59,7 +59,7 @@ void lttng_action_init(struct lttng_action *action, action->serialize = serialize; action->equal = equal; action->destroy = destroy; - action->get_firing_policy = get_firing_policy; + action->get_rate_policy = get_rate_policy; action->execution_request_counter = 0; action->execution_counter = 0; @@ -271,21 +271,21 @@ void lttng_action_increase_execution_failure_count(struct lttng_action *action) LTTNG_HIDDEN bool lttng_action_should_execute(const struct lttng_action *action) { - const struct lttng_firing_policy *policy = NULL; + const struct lttng_rate_policy *policy = NULL; bool execute = false; - if (action->get_firing_policy == NULL) { + if (action->get_rate_policy == NULL) { execute = true; goto end; } - policy = action->get_firing_policy(action); + policy = action->get_rate_policy(action); if (policy == NULL) { execute = true; goto end; } - execute = lttng_firing_policy_should_execute( + execute = lttng_rate_policy_should_execute( policy, action->execution_request_counter); end: return execute;